Tucked away on a Plymouth street you'd walk past without noticing, this place turns out to be a genuinely easy family dinner. The menu mixes Greek dishes with familiar restaurant favourites, so fussy eaters and adventurous ones both find something, and there's a kids' menu, high chairs, vegan options and free parking, which takes the sting out of a night with small children. Portions are generous — the garlic mushrooms and prawn cocktail get particular praise, and people order extra bread to mop up. Staff are plentiful and quick to sort problems without fuss, and they'll happily handle a birthday cake. Buggy access and outdoor seating help if you need to escape the room. Worth knowing: tables near the open grill get hot, and it fills up in the evenings, so book if you can.
